Following the fracas that ensued in Ilesha Baruba on Friday morning involving some community residents and operatives of the Federal Government’s Joint Task Force on Border Patrol, Kwara Governor, A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q has described the incident as “sad, unfortunate and definitely avoidable”.
A statement signed by the Chief Press Secretary to the Governor reads, “The Governor sincerely commiserates with the Emir of Ilesha Baruba Prof. Halidu Abubakar and families of those who lost their lives in the unfortunate incident and definitely avoidable.”
The governor also promised to restore peace in the community by sending “a government delegation” to the area to establish all the facts and forestall a repeat of the sad incident.
It was also contained that the Governor has been in constant touch with the Traditional leader of the community to find a lasting solution to the fracas so as to avoid future occurrences.
